“Kenta, Kilts, and Kimonos” by Dorothy White is the topic of discussion at November’s MTLT Journal Club. This article was first published in 2001 in the legacy journal Teaching Children Mathematics.

In this episode of Classroom Conversations, we will share how we developed geometry tasks based on how kindergarten students engaged with pattern blocks during free play. The 'new' tasks provide opportunities to go beyond the standards as well as foster several standards for mathematical practice.
